What is Radisson Gold?

Radisson Gold is the middle tier elite status for Radisson Rewards. It compares pretty closely to other middle tier elite statuses like Marriott Gold and Hyatt Explorist in terms of nights required and also benefits offered.

Qualifying for Radisson Gold

Hotel stays

You can qualify for Radisson Gold status by completing 30 nights or 20 stays within a calendar year. Below are the requirements for all of the Radisson elite levels.

Elite LevelNightsStays
Club00
Silver96
Gold3020
Platinum6030

Once you qualify for any elite tier, you will maintain that status for the remainder of the then-current calendar year and through the following “Program year,” which runs from March 1 to February 28/29.

This means that if you earned Gold status in May 2021, you would maintain it through 2021, 2022, and then until the end of February 2023.

Credit card

You can get automatic Radisson Gold status with the Radisson Rewards Premier Visa Signature Card.

That card is one of the more underrated hotel credit cards and it offers you benefits like 10 extra points per dollar spent on Radisson hotels and up to three free nights.

Basically, you can get one free night for every $10,000 in spend which is a pretty sweet perk. (I’m not aware of any other hotel cards that offer free nights at such a lucrative pace.) The annual fee is also only $75 which means that you can get a lot of bang for your buck with this card.

Radisson Gold Benefits

  • Bonus earnings
  • Complimentary room upgrade
  • Early check-in and late check-out
  • Room availability guarantee
  • Discounts on food & beverage
  • Complimentary water

Bonus earnings

As a Radisson Gold member, you will earn 25 points per one dollar spent on your hotel stays. Compare that to a basic club member that will earn 20 points per dollar spent.

If you are familiar with other hotel programs, 25 points per dollar for a middle tier elite status is a lot of points. The bad news is that these hotel points hold a small amount of value compared to most of the programs.

In fact, you might value these points around .36 cents per point. This means that 25 points per dollar would amount to somewhere around a 10% return on your spend.

That is still pretty decent but just not quite as attractive as you might initially think it is.

Complimentary room upgrade

You will be entitled to one complimentary room upgrade per Elite member per eligible stay.

The actual upgrade that you receive will be determined by the participating hotel depending on availability at the time of check-in.

This means that the upgrades could vary widely but generally you could expect something like a room in a preferred location, a room with a preferred view, or a recently renovated room.

As a Gold member, I would not have expectations to be bumped to a higher room category since the terms state that those are benefits for Platinum members. 

Early check-in and late check-out

Early check-in and late check-out is based on availability and available only when the Elite member is the registered guest.

One thing that is unique and great about Radisson is that they are pretty specific about what they mean by early check-in and late checkout.

They state that, “Early check-in and late check-out means two hours prior to or two hours later than the hotel’s published check-in and check-out time.”

Typically, check in time will be around 3 PM and check out will be around 11 AM.

So if you were able to take advantage of this benefit you would be looking at a check-in time around 1 PM and a check-out time around 1 PM.

This is not to say that you can never check in earlier or check out later. A lot of hotels can be pretty flexible about these times so the trick is to just inquire with the hotel.

Related reading: Ultimate Late Check-Out Guide for Hotel Stays

Room availability guarantee

You can receive a guaranteed room availability up to 72 hours prior to checking in for an eligible stay. (The time is calculated from noon local hotel time.)

The room availability will likely be limited to a standard room at a standard rate. Keep in mind that this benefit is not available for reservations for award nights or Points + Cash nights, and is not available at the Radisson Blu Polar Hotel Spitsbergen, or when a nationally or internationally recognized event is occurring within fifty miles of a hotel.

Discounts on food & beverage

You will receive a 15% discount on food and beverages at participating hotel restaurants. If you would like to check to see if your hotel is available for the discount, check out this list here.

If your state is in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and Asia Pacific, you may need to contact the hotel directly to verify that it is participating.

There are some exclusions to the discount so you won’t be able to apply it to things like tips, alcoholic beverages, room service or in-room dining, catering or banquets, or groups or parties of six or more.

You will also be responsible for requesting the discount at the time you settle your bill or some time before. So be sure to bring this up as soon as you take your seat at a participating restaurant because the discount cannot be applied at the hotel’s front desk.

Complimentary water

You should be provided with two bottles of water per stay.

Radisson Gold FAQ

Do Radisson Gold members get upgrades?

Yes, you will be entitled to an upgrade based on availability. Most likely this will involve a bump to a room in a preferred location such as a room with a better view or a recently renovated room.

How many extra bonus points do you earn with Radisson Gold?

You can earn an extra five points per dollar spent for a total of 25 points per dollar spent.

Do Radisson Gold members get late check-out?

Yes, subject to availability Gold members will receive late check out which will typically be two hours past the standard to check out time.

Do Radisson Gold members get free breakfast?

Unfortunately, no. Gold members do not get a free breakfast.

Final word

Radisson Gold is a pretty standard middle tier elite status level. It is not offered a free breakfast but it does come with perks like upgrades, a decent bonus earning rate, and the potential for early check in or late check out.
